On 04/06/2016 03:55 AM, John Wiegley wrote:
there still needs to be a third
choice, for specifying an arbitrary function.

Sure, and we can also use `radio' and `function-item' like in message-send-mail-function's definition. My sole point is that a defcustom where the value is a function is a reasonable, and in this case a desirable, thing to do.

Maybe we shouldn't advertise the "write your own function" possibility too much, since the required signature can still change abruptly, but that's a minor concern.
